Hansol Holdings Decides on Cash Dividend of 120 Won per Share
[Asia Economy Reporter Kim Jong-hwa] Hansol Holdings announced on the 14th that it has decided to pay a cash dividend of 120 KRW per common share. The dividend yield is 3.4% for common shares, and the total dividend amount is 5.04 billion KRW.

Hansol Holdings held a board meeting on the 14th and finalized this decision. According to the shareholder return policy announced in June 2019, Hansol Holdings utilizes 30-40% of the annual free cash flow (on a separate basis) within the range of distributable profits as resources for the shareholder return policy, which includes cash dividends and share repurchases and cancellations.
